About 1-(2-hydroxybenzoyl)piperidin-4-one

1-(2-hydroxybenzoyl)piperidin-4-one (PubChem CID 24689914) has the molecular formula C12H13NO3 and a molecular weight of 219.24 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is 1-(2-hydroxybenzoyl)piperidin-4-one.
